Oracle E-Business Suite Release 12.2 Cloning/Refresh


Cloning is the process of creating an identical copy of the existing system. There are various scenarios that require cloning an Oracle E­Business Suite system:
Standard cloning ­ Copying an existing Oracle E­Business Suite system, for example, to test updates against a duplicate of a production system.
System scale­up ­ Adding new machines to an Oracle E­Business Suite system to provide capacity for processing increased workloads.
System transformations ­ Altering system data or file systems, including actions such as platform migration, provisioning of high availability architectures, and data scrambling.
Patching and upgrading ­ Delivering new versions of Oracle E­Business Suite components, and providing a mechanism to create rolling environments that minimize downtimes.
